WebMar 9, 2024 · Let’s say someone in the 22% tax bracket withdraws $10,000 from their 401 (k) to pay off their student loans. They would end up paying $2,200 in taxes to the IRS come tax time, on top of a 10% ... Loans WebJul 2, 2024 · With student loan interest, the tax codes can work in your favor, as you may be able to claim a deduction of up to $2,500 on interest paid. That essentially gives you a lower after-tax interest rate. With stocks, it's the opposite. If you sell them, you’ll have to pay capital gains taxes on your earnings, which lowers your net gains.
